When it comes to investing in a mobile incinerator, one of the most crucial factors to consider is the price Mobile incinerators are essential tools in waste management, particularly for industries that generate a significant amount of waste on a regular basis However, determining the price of a mobile incinerator can be a complex process, as there are several factors that can influence the final cost In this article, we will explore the various factors that can impact the price of a mobile incinerator.
1 Size and Capacity
One of the primary factors that will influence the price of a mobile incinerator is its size and capacity Mobile incinerators come in a variety of sizes, ranging from small units that can process a few hundred pounds of waste per hour to large units that can handle several tons of waste per hour The larger the incinerator, the higher the price is likely to be It is essential to determine the volume of waste that needs to be processed on a regular basis before investing in a mobile incinerator to ensure that the selected unit can meet the demand.
2 Technology and Features
The technology and features incorporated into a mobile incinerator can also impact its price Advanced features such as automatic temperature control, continuous feeding systems, and remote monitoring capabilities can significantly increase the cost of a mobile incinerator While these features can enhance the efficiency and ease of operation of the incinerator, they may not be necessary for all applications It is essential to carefully evaluate the specific needs of your waste management operation to determine which features are essential and which can be omitted to control costs.
3 Emission Control Systems
Environmental regulations regarding emissions from incinerators are becoming increasingly stringent Mobile incinerators must comply with these regulations to ensure that air quality is not compromised during the waste disposal process mobile incinerator price. The inclusion of advanced emission control systems such as scrubbers, filters, and catalytic converters can add to the cost of a mobile incinerator However, investing in high-quality emission control systems is essential to avoid fines and penalties for non-compliance with emission standards.
4 Fuel Efficiency
The fuel efficiency of a mobile incinerator can also impact its price Incinerators that are designed to burn waste efficiently and generate maximum heat output from a minimal amount of fuel are likely to be more expensive upfront However, investing in a fuel-efficient incinerator can result in significant cost savings over time, as fuel expenses will be reduced It is essential to consider the long-term operating costs of a mobile incinerator when evaluating its price to determine the most cost-effective option for your waste management operation.
5 Manufacturer and Brand
The reputation and experience of the manufacturer can also influence the price of a mobile incinerator Established brands with a history of producing high-quality incineration equipment may charge a premium for their products While it may be tempting to opt for a lower-priced incinerator from a less reputable manufacturer, it is essential to consider the quality and reliability of the equipment to avoid costly maintenance and repairs in the future Investing in a reputable brand with a proven track record of performance and durability can provide peace of mind and long-term value for your waste management operation.
In conclusion, the price of a mobile incinerator is influenced by a variety of factors, including size and capacity, technology and features, emission control systems, fuel efficiency, and manufacturer By carefully evaluating these factors and understanding their impact on the overall cost, waste management professionals can make informed decisions when investing in a mobile incinerator While price is an important consideration, it is essential to prioritize quality, efficiency, and compliance with environmental regulations to ensure the success and sustainability of a waste management operation.
